Cold heading process is one of the new processes for pressure machining of less or no cutting
metal. It is a processing method that utilizes the plastic deformation of metal under the action of
external forces, and with the aid of molds, redistributes and transfers the volume of metal to form
the required parts or blanks. The cold heading process is most suitable for producing standard
fasteners such as bolts, screws, nuts, rivets, and pins.etc
Gold-Plated Snow Blower Shear Bolts are specialized fasteners designed for snow blowers and other snow removal equipment. These bolts act as mechanical fuses, breaking under excessive load to protect the auger or drivetrain from damage. The gold plating offers both functional and aesthetic benefits:
Features:
-
Shear Functionality – Engineered to snap at a specific torque threshold, preventing costly damage to the snow blower’s gearbox or auger when hitting obstacles like ice, rocks, or debris.

-
Gold Plating – Provides corrosion resistance, reducing rust and wear in harsh winter conditions (salt, moisture, freeze-thaw cycles).
-
Precision Calibration – Made to OEM specifications to ensure consistent shear strength and reliable performance.
-
Easy Identification – The gold finish makes them easily distinguishable from standard bolts, aiding in quick replacement.
-
Durability – Often made from hardened steel with a gold electroplated coating for longevity.

Replacement Tips:
-
Always use the correct shear bolt grade specified by the manufacturer.
-
Avoid substituting regular bolts, as they may not shear properly, leading to equipment damage.
-
Check and replace shear bolts at the start of each winter season.
